#2fd965 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2fd965 is composed of 18.4% red, 85.1%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.5%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 139.1 degrees, a saturation of 69.1% and a lightness of 51.8%. #2fd965 color hex could be obtained by blending #5effca with #00b300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#2fd965 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2fd965 has RGB values of R:47, G:217,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 3135845.

Shades and Tints of #2fd965

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010803 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f8 is the lightest one.
